I. Classification of Core Duplomatic Gear Pump Series
1. External Gear Pumps (Standard & High Pressure)
|
Series
|
Features
|
Displacement Range
|
Pressure Rating
|
Typical Applications
|
|
GP Series
|
Aluminum alloy external gear pump, axial clearance compensation, low noise, high efficiency, three frame sizes
|
1.3–87.6 cm³/rev
|
Standard 230 bar, High version up to 310 bar
|
General industrial machinery, automation equipment, auxiliary hydraulic circuits
|
|
GPA Series
|
Enhanced high-pressure external gear pump, reinforced structure, improved sealing system
|
Up to 61 cm³/rev
|
Max 260 bar continuous pressure
|
High-precision machine tools, heavy-duty automated production lines
|
|
GPM Series
|
Modular multi-section external gear pump, flexible combined flow, compact layout
|
Custom combined displacement
|
Rated 210–230 bar
|
Multi-circuit hydraulic systems, customized industrial equipment
|
2. Internal Gear Pumps (Low Noise, Ultra-High Pressure)
|
Series
|
Features
|
Displacement Range
|
Pressure Rating
|
Typical Applications
|
|
IGP Series
|
Precision internal gear pump, radial & axial pressure compensation, ultra-low noise, long service life
|
10–251.7 cm³/rev
|
Standard 250 bar, peak up to 330 bar
|
High-end machine tools, servo hydraulic systems, precision automation, injection molding machines
|
|
IGP-H Series
|
High-pressure upgraded version of IGP series, optimized bearing and sealing structure
|
16–160 cm³/rev
|
Peak pressure 310 bar, stable high-load operation
|
Heavy industrial high-pressure circuits, die-casting and molding equipment
|

IV. Selection Guidelines
-
Pressure Selection: Standard GP series suits 210–230 bar medium-pressure working conditions; GP-H/GPA high-pressure versions adapt to 260–310 bar heavy-load scenarios; IGP internal gear pumps support up to 330 bar peak pressure for ultra-high-precision systems.
-
Noise & Stability Requirements: IGP internal gear pumps feature meshing gap compensation and low pulsation, ideal for silent machine tools, servo hydraulics and high-end automation equipment; GP external pumps are cost-effective for conventional general industrial scenarios.
-
Flow Combination Demand: GPM multi-section combined pumps can match different front and rear stage displacements, meeting simultaneous high and low flow demands of multi-circuit hydraulic systems and optimizing system layout.
-
Working Medium & Environment: All series support standard mineral hydraulic oil; optional special seals are available for low-temperature, high-temperature and anti-corrosion working environments, with strong environmental adaptability.
-
Cost Performance: GP series is preferred for ordinary auxiliary circuits and general power circuits; IGP series is recommended for core precision hydraulic circuits requiring low noise and high stability; GPA/GP-H are selected for long-term high-pressure continuous operation.
